attacks on the endangered attwater's prairie-chicken (tympanuchus cupido attwateri) by black flies (diptera: simuliidae) infected with an avian blood parasite.with fewer than 50 birds remaining in the wild, attwater's prairie-chicken (tympanuchus cupido attwateri) is critically endangered. individuals of this species on the attwater prairie chicken national wildlife refuge, colorado co., tx, have been attacked in successive winters, 2005-2006, by the blood-feeding black fly cnephia ornithophilia. attwater's prairie-chicken is a previously unreported host for cnephia ornithophilia. molecular screening indicated that about 15% of 13 blood-fed flies samp ...200718260522
